Transaction 159e56aea2f9065624c2be009e8c5b7dee9605efbd91c9e76a8a103721d1f7e8

1 Input
2 Outputs
  • 159e56aea2f9065624c2be009e8c5b7dee9605efbd91c9e76a8a103721d1f7e8:0
  • value  1151418
    address  14opuxMMrWG8qQVaS5KDLoA4irfoHAz4y5
  • 159e56aea2f9065624c2be009e8c5b7dee9605efbd91c9e76a8a103721d1f7e8:1
  • value  522507
    address  1KznLd3CDLHrYgGSSd1WL44qMQCJKbYJNm